Kangaroo Island was the site of the first settlement in South Australia. It was initially surveyed as a site for a new port to serve the southern coast,but there were not enough good agricultural prospects to sustain a colony, so surveying continued on the mainland. However, Kangaroo Island became a popular location for sealers and whalers. It was also the island that saved Matthew Flinders' crew from starvation during their circumnavigation of te continent. Flinders named the island for the abundance of kangaroos found there.
